Buying Problem

Wholesale canvas grocery totes for natural grocers sit in a difficult middle ground. They are not luxury fashion bags, but they are also not disposable promotional totes. Customers load them with jars, produce, frozen food, bottles, and boxed goods, then reuse them many times. If the bag feels too thin, the print rubs off, or the handles pull out, the product reflects badly on the retailer even when the unit price looked attractive on the purchase order.

The most common sourcing mistake is treating a canvas grocery tote as a simple flat cotton tote with a larger size. A grocery tote needs capacity, handle strength, bottom shape, clean folding, and print durability. The RFQ should give the factory enough data to quote the real construction, not the cheapest interpretation. The checklist below is built for buyers comparing factory quotes, approving samples, and setting inspection criteria before shipment.

  • Define the bag by function: grocery load, checkout handling, shelf presentation, and reuse cycle.
  • Separate visual requirements from strength requirements so the supplier cannot hide weak sewing behind a nice print.
  • Use one approved sample as the control for fabric handfeel, print appearance, sewing, and folding.

Core Specification

For natural grocers, the safest starting point is a cotton canvas grocery tote in the 10 oz to 12 oz range, roughly 340-400 GSM depending on weaving and finishing. An 8 oz canvas can work for light produce or giveaway use, but it often feels too soft for paid retail bags or heavy grocery loads. A 14 oz canvas looks premium and stands better, but it raises unit cost, carton weight, and freight cost. The right choice depends on whether the tote is sold, gifted, or used as a loyalty program item.

Dimensions should be based on real contents. A common grocery tote body might sit around 38 x 40 cm with a 10-12 cm bottom gusset, but each buyer should test the size with products from the store: cereal box, wine bottle if relevant, produce pack, jar, and frozen bag. Handle drop also matters. Short handles feel stable by hand but are less comfortable on the shoulder. Long handles improve carrying comfort but increase stress at the attachment point.

  • Typical fabric range: 10 oz for value programs, 12 oz for stronger retail presentation, 14 oz for premium heavy-duty use.
  • Useful grocery structure: bottom gusset or boxed bottom instead of a flat promotional tote.
  • Handle drop: define finished measurement and tolerance, not just total handle length.
  • Tolerance example: body dimensions +/-1 cm, handle drop +/-1 cm, print position +/-0.5 cm, adjusted to your acceptance level.

Fabric Choices

Natural unbleached canvas is popular for grocers because it matches organic and low-plastic positioning, but it is not a perfectly uniform material. Cotton seed flecks, slight shade differences, and minor yarn variation may be normal if they are present in the approved swatch. If the brand requires a cleaner surface for detailed printing, bleached canvas or dyed canvas may be more suitable. That decision should be made before artwork approval, because the base fabric color changes print appearance.

Buyers should also clarify whether the canvas is stock fabric, dyed to order, or specially woven. Stock fabric helps MOQ and lead time, but shade and availability can change. Dyed-to-order fabric gives better brand control but adds lab dip approval, dyeing MOQ, and schedule risk. Special weaving gives the most control over weight and handfeel, but it only makes sense when the order quantity supports the setup.

  • Unbleached canvas: natural look, lower processing, variable shade and flecks.
  • Bleached canvas: cleaner print base, less natural appearance, may show dirt faster.
  • Dyed canvas: stronger brand color control, requires lab dip and colorfastness review.
  • Washed canvas: softer handfeel, more shrinkage control needed, higher processing cost.

Print Decisions

Most canvas grocery totes for natural grocers use screen printing because it gives strong solid-color coverage at a practical cost. Water-based ink is often preferred for a softer, matte finish, especially on natural canvas. Plastisol or heavier ink systems can improve opacity in some cases, but the handfeel may be less suitable for a natural grocery brand. Digital print works for small quantities or detailed artwork, but it is usually not the first choice for a simple one-color store logo on a wholesale order.

Artwork should be tested on the actual fabric color. A green logo that looks bright on a digital proof may look muted on unbleached canvas. Fine lines can fill in on textured canvas, and large solid blocks can show uneven absorption. The pre-production sample should include the final print size, final ink type, final print position, and curing conditions. Do not approve artwork only from a PDF proof.

  • Best for simple logos: screen print, 1-3 spot colors, Pantone references used as targets rather than absolute guarantees on natural fabric.
  • Best for detailed images: digital print or heat transfer, with careful wash and rub testing.
  • Risk area: large dark ink blocks on coarse canvas can feel stiff and show cracking when folded.
  • Inspection point: dry rub, tape adhesion, curing, print edge sharpness, registration, and position.

Cost Drivers

Canvas tote pricing is driven first by fabric consumption. A gusseted grocery tote uses more fabric than a flat tote, and a heavier GSM increases cost again. Handle width, handle length, inner seams, bottom reinforcement, labels, hangtags, and folding labor all add cost. When two supplier quotes differ sharply, the lower quote often has a lighter fabric, smaller gusset, narrower handles, simpler stitching, or cheaper packing.

MOQ logic usually follows fabric and print setup. If the order uses stock natural canvas and a one-color screen print, a factory may support a lower MOQ. If the order needs dyed canvas, custom webbing, multiple store artwork versions, or special packing, the practical MOQ rises. Buyers comparing quotes should request price breaks at realistic volumes, such as 500, 1000, 3000, and 5000 pieces, with the same specification held constant.

  • Main cost levers: fabric GSM, bag size, gusset depth, handle construction, print colors, labels, packing, and inspection requirements.
  • Quote comparison rule: reject any quote that does not state fabric weight, size, print method, packing, and Incoterms.
  • Setup costs: screen charges, sample fees, lab dip fees, barcode label setup, and special carton marking may be separate.
  • Freight impact: heavier canvas and individual packing can increase carton volume and landed cost even when unit price looks acceptable.

Sample Approval

A good sample approval process prevents most mass production disputes. The first sample can confirm size and construction, but the pre-production sample should use actual bulk fabric or confirmed production fabric. It should also use the final print method and the same handle reinforcement planned for the order. If the approved sample uses a better fabric or cleaner sewing than bulk production, the inspection standard becomes weak.

Procurement teams should write comments directly on a measurement sheet and photo record. Record finished width, height, bottom gusset, handle width, handle drop, print size, print position, label position, carton folding method, and any agreed fabric character. Keep one signed sample with the buyer and one with the factory. For distributor programs with several store logos, approve each artwork position and color because small changes can create mixed-quality shipments.

  • Approve actual fabric weight and color, not only the bag shape.
  • Load the sample with real grocery items and carry it for a short practical test.
  • Fold the printed panel as it will be packed and check for cracking or transfer.
  • Photograph approved stitching at the handle attachment and top hem for inspector reference.

Inspection Thresholds

A standard AQL inspection is useful, but grocery totes also need function checks. Visual defects such as stains, poor print, skewed sewing, and loose threads matter because the bag is brand-visible. Functional defects such as weak handles, open seams, and undersized gussets matter because the bag is used under load. The purchase order should state which defects are critical, major, and minor before production starts.

For handle strength, buyers can define a practical test instead of relying on vague wording like strong handles. For example, the factory can hang a defined weight for a defined time and inspect stitch distortion, seam opening, and handle slippage. The exact weight should match the intended use and safety margin. This is not a substitute for laboratory testing when required, but it gives the factory and inspector a clear production control point.

  • Critical defects: broken handle attachment, open bottom seam, sharp contamination, wrong artwork, wrong material, mold, severe oil stains.
  • Major defects: print peeling, obvious color mismatch, incorrect size beyond tolerance, twisted handles, skipped stitches at stress points, carton quantity errors.
  • Minor defects: small loose threads, slight shade variation within approved range, minor fold marks, small print specks within agreed limit.
  • Function checks: handle pull, seam tension, print rub, folding recovery, barcode scan, carton drop or compression review where needed.

Packing Control

Packing affects both cost and product condition. Flat folding in bulk cartons is efficient for warehouse distribution, but it can create fold lines across the print if the artwork is placed in the wrong area. Individual polybags improve cleanliness for retail handling, but they add labor, plastic use, carton volume, and unpacking work at store level. Paper bands or bundle packing can be a practical middle option for natural grocers that want lower plastic use.

Carton data should be included in the quote because landed cost depends on cube and gross weight. Ask for estimated pieces per carton, carton dimensions, gross weight, net weight, and carton board strength. Overfilled cartons can deform the bags and create deep creases. Underfilled cartons waste freight space. If the totes ship to a retailer distribution center, carton marks, barcodes, and pallet rules must be finalized before packing starts.

  • Common options: bulk fold, bundle pack, individual recycled polybag, paper band, hangtag with barcode.
  • Packing approval: folded size, print fold direction, pieces per inner bundle, carton quantity, carton marks, desiccant if needed.
  • Distribution risk: mixed artwork versions should use clear inner labels and carton labels to prevent store allocation errors.
  • Moisture risk: natural cotton canvas should be packed dry and stored away from damp floors before container loading.

Lead Time Risk

Lead time is not only sewing time. Canvas procurement, dyeing, lab dip approval, sample revision, print screen preparation, bulk printing, curing, sewing, trimming, pressing, packing, inspection, and export booking all take time. A simple stock-fabric order may move quickly after sample approval, while a dyed canvas order with several artwork versions needs more control points. The buyer should map these steps before promising an in-store launch date.

Schedule risk usually appears when artwork approval is late, lab dips are rejected, fabric shade changes, or packing requirements change after production starts. Natural grocers often add hangtags, recycled-content claims, store labels, or retail barcodes near the end of the order. Those items should be part of the first RFQ because they affect material buying, sample approval, and packing labor.

  • Typical sequence: RFQ, sample, sample comments, pre-production sample, fabric booking, print approval, bulk production, inspection, packing, shipment.
  • Risk items: dyed fabric, multiple logo versions, barcode labels, individual packing, third-party inspection booking, peak-season freight space.
  • Control method: set approval deadlines for artwork, lab dips, samples, and carton labels in the purchase order.
  • Buffer: first orders need more time than repeat orders because standards and corrections are still being established.

Quote Comparison

A usable supplier quote should allow side-by-side comparison without guessing. At minimum, it should list fabric type and weight, finished size, handle size, print method, number of print colors, label details, packing method, carton quantity, sample cost, unit price by quantity, production lead time, Incoterms, and payment terms. If a supplier gives only a photo and a unit price, the buyer cannot know what is being quoted.

For landed-cost comparison, add freight and handling impact. A heavier 12 oz bag may have a higher unit price than an 8 oz bag, but if it reduces customer complaints and supports paid retail use, it may be the better commercial decision. On the other hand, adding individual polybags to every tote can increase unit cost, packing labor, carton volume, and sustainability concerns. The best quote is the one that matches the store use case with the least hidden risk.

  • Compare equal specs: same GSM, same size, same handle reinforcement, same print, same packing, same Incoterms.
  • Request quantity breaks: 500, 1000, 3000, and 5000 pieces if those volumes match your buying plan.
  • Separate one-time costs: screens, samples, lab dips, special labels, hangtag setup, and inspection support.
  • Score supplier evidence: sample accuracy, measurement sheet, fabric swatch, production photos, inspection cooperation, and clear carton data.

Specification comparison for buyers

Spec decisionRecommended optionWhen it fitsBuyer risk to check
Fabric weight for grocery use10 oz to 12 oz cotton canvas, roughly 340-400 GSM before washingReusable produce and dry grocery bags where the tote must stand up better than a thin giveaway bagQuotes based on 8 oz canvas may look cheaper but can feel soft, wrinkle badly, and fail handle load expectations
Handle constructionSelf-fabric handles, 2.5-3.5 cm wide, reinforced with cross-stitch or box-X stitchingNatural grocer checkout bags, loyalty gifts, and paid reusable bagsLong handles without enough stitch area can tear at the top hem under canned or bottled goods
Bag size and gussetApprox. 38 x 40 cm body with 10-12 cm bottom gusset, adjusted to buyer shelf and checkout needsGeneral grocery use where buyers carry mixed produce, jars, packaged food, and supplementsFlat totes may photograph well but are less useful at checkout because they do not sit open or hold bulky items
Print methodWater-based screen print for 1-3 solid colors; digital print only for short runs or detailed artworkNatural grocer branding where a matte, low-gloss print is preferredHeavy ink coverage on unbleached canvas can crack or look dull if artwork is not adjusted for fabric color
Fabric colorNatural unbleached canvas with controlled shade range, or dyed canvas with lab dip approvalOrganic, natural, and local-food positioning where the bag should not look syntheticUnbleached cotton shade varies by batch; approve tolerance instead of expecting paper-white consistency
MOQ logicFactory MOQ tied to fabric stock, print setup, and packing method; common planning range 500-1000 pcs per color/designImporters consolidating multiple store programs or seasonal campaignsVery low MOQ may mean stock fabric only, limited color control, higher unit price, or less efficient inspection
Inner packingFlat folded bulk pack or 10-25 pcs per recyclable polybag depending on retail handlingWarehouse distribution, store replenishment, or e-commerce bundle packingIndividual polybags increase labor, carton volume, plastic use, and inspection time
QC inspection levelAQL inspection with added function tests for handle pull, seam strength, print adhesion, and carton drop riskPaid retail totes and brand-visible reusable bagsA general visual inspection alone can miss weak bartacks, short handles, skewed gussets, and rubbing print defects

Buyer checklist before sampling

  1. Define bag size by usable capacity, not only flat dimensions; include body width, height, bottom gusset, side gusset if any, and handle drop.
  2. State fabric clearly: cotton canvas, yarn-dyed or piece-dyed if applicable, target oz or GSM, color, shrinkage tolerance, and whether washed or unwashed finish is required.
  3. Require a pre-production sample using actual fabric weight, final handle width, final stitching method, and final print artwork.
  4. Set load expectations for grocery use, such as a practical static hanging load and a short carry simulation, instead of relying only on fabric weight.
  5. Specify print method, artwork size, Pantone or reference color, ink type preference, print position tolerance, and whether print cracking after folding is acceptable.
  6. Define sewing acceptance: no open seams, skipped stitches, loose threads over an agreed length, twisted handles, uneven top hem, or visible oil marks.
  7. Approve packing before mass production: folding method, pieces per inner pack, carton quantity, carton strength, carton marks, barcode labels, and pallet limits if needed.
  8. Request quote lines for sample cost, mold or screen cost, unit price by quantity break, packing method, lead time after approval, and Incoterms.
  9. Reserve time for incoming inspection or third-party inspection before shipment, especially for first orders or paid retail tote programs.
  10. Keep a signed golden sample and measurement sheet so the factory, buyer, and inspector use the same standard.

Factory quote questions to send

  1. What canvas weight are you quoting in oz and GSM, and is that weight measured before or after any washing or finishing?
  2. Is the fabric in stock, greige, dyed to order, or specially woven for this order, and what MOQ applies to each route?
  3. What is the maximum recommended print area for the selected canvas weight and bag size without causing heavy ink handfeel or cracking?
  4. Which stitching method will be used at the handle attachment, and what load test can your factory perform before shipment?
  5. Can the pre-production sample be made from actual bulk fabric and actual production print screens or digital print settings?
  6. What measurement tolerances do you apply for body size, gusset, handle width, and handle drop?
  7. How many pieces per carton are included in the quote, what is the estimated carton size and gross weight, and can the carton pass export handling?
  8. Are individual polybags, recycled polybags, paper bands, hangtags, barcodes, or carton labels included or quoted separately?
  9. What is the production lead time after sample approval and deposit, and which materials or processes can extend that schedule?
  10. Which inspection standard do you accept before shipment, and will you replace or rework units that exceed the agreed defect limit?

Quality-control points to confirm

  1. Fabric weight should match the approved specification within an agreed tolerance, with no obvious thin panels, slubs beyond the approved fabric character, holes, stains, or severe shade variation.
  2. Finished bag dimensions should stay within the approved tolerance for width, height, gusset, handle width, and handle drop; grocery totes need usable volume and comfortable carry length.
  3. Handle attachment must be reinforced consistently, with no broken stitches, skipped stitches, weak bartacks, or handle ends slipping out from under the top hem.
  4. Top hem, side seams, and bottom gusset should be straight enough for retail presentation and strong enough for repeated loading.
  5. Print should meet approved artwork size, position, color tolerance, coverage, curing, and adhesion standards; rubbing, tackiness, ghosting, and registration shift should be classified before inspection.
  6. Labels, hangtags, barcodes, and carton marks must match the purchase order and packing list because mixed store programs are costly to sort after arrival.
  7. Packing should protect the bags from moisture, crushing, and dirt during export shipping; cartons should not be overfilled to the point of deforming folded totes.
  8. A retained golden sample, approved fabric swatch, and approved print strike-off should be available to the final inspector.
